Why Is Gooseberry An Insult?
When ‘play gooseberry’ was coined, in 19th century England, it referred to someone acting as a chaperone to a couple. It was widely accepted in middle class circles that it would be improper for a woman of good character to be alone with a man of marriageable age. What does calling someone a gooseberry mean? […]

How Far Apart Should You Plant Gooseberry Bushes?
Plant bare-root gooseberries between late autumn and early spring, and container-grown plants at any time, avoiding waterlogged, parched or frozen soil. Bushes: space 1.2–1.5m (4–5ft) apart. Do you need two gooseberry bushes? Answer: Most gooseberry and currant varieties are self-fruitful. It is not necessary to plant two or more varieties for cross-pollination and fruit set. […]

How Did Rainbow Trout Get To California?
Wild resident Coastal Rainbow trout are more abundant today than they were historically in California due to a long history of introductions by pack mule trains, airplanes, and other means, especially into previously fishless high elevation lakes in the Sierra Nevada.
